Word of the day
for January 23
leporine adj
  1. (chiefly mammalogy, also figuratively) Of, relating to, or resembling a hare or rabbit.

leporine n (mammalogy)

  1. Synonym of leporid (any mammal of the family Leporidae: the hares and rabbits)
  2. (historical) A supposed hybrid between a hare and a rabbit, now known not to exist; a leporide.

Today is the second day of the Chinese New Year. According to the Chinese zodiac, it is the year of the rabbit.
